Introduction
Binary is the language computers speak at the hardware level — but humans think in characters. Binary translation bridges that gap: mapping each letter, digit, and symbol to its bit pattern, and reconstructing readable text from streams of zeros and ones. Computer science curricula, capture-the-flag challenges, and serial protocol specifications all assume you can move fluently between "Hi" and 01001000 01101001.

What this tool does
Text → Binary: Each character becomes an 8-bit (or 7-bit) binary string. Separators between bytes improve readability.
Binary → Text: Concatenated bit patterns decode back to UTF-8 text when bit length aligns with character boundaries.
Example:
| Direction | Value |
|---|---|
| Text | Hi |
| Binary (8-bit, spaced) | 01001000 01101001 |
How it works
- Encoding: TextEncoder produces UTF-8 bytes. Each byte renders as binary padded to selected width (7 or 8 bits).
- Decoding: Non-binary characters stripped. Bit stream split into chunks of N bits. Chunks → bytes → TextDecoder.
Errors surface when bit count is not divisible by the selected width — preventing shifted decode garbage.
7-bit vs 8-bit
| Mode | Range | Typical use |
|---|---|---|
| 7-bit | 0–127 | Legacy ASCII, teletype, some RFID |
| 8-bit | 0–255 | Modern ASCII superset, UTF-8 bytes |
UTF-8 emoji and CJK require multiple 8-bit bytes per character when encoding full strings.
Real-world examples
CS101 homework verification
Assignment: encode your name in binary. Encode locally, compare against manual worksheet before submission.
UART serial sniffing
Logic analyzer exports:
01001000 01100101 01101100 01101100 01101111
Binary → Text → Hello confirms baud rate and framing configuration.
Steganography and puzzle games
Alternate reality games hide messages in binary audio spectrograms. Paste extracted bits to recover plaintext clues.
RFID and Wiegand bit layouts
Access control systems document facility codes as binary fields within 26-bit or 34-bit frames. Visualize character payloads separately from facility encoding.
Common mistakes
Decoding UTF-8 multibyte characters as single bytes. Emoji 😀 requires four 8-bit chunks. Decoding 8 bits at a time produces mojibake.
Including spaces in bit count validation. The tool strips non-0/1 characters, but inconsistent grouping causes off-by-one errors if manual editing introduced stray bits.
Using 7-bit mode on extended ASCII. Characters above code point 127 truncate or encode incorrectly in 7-bit mode.
Confusing with Binary Converter. Numeric base conversion (255 ↔ 11111111) differs from character encoding ("A" ↔ 01000001).
Expecting compression. Binary translation expands data dramatically — 8 characters become 64+ bits. Not suitable for storage optimization.

Educational note: ASCII 'A' = 65 = 0x41 = 01000001
These four representations describe the same value through different lenses. Proficiency moving between them accelerates debugging across stack layers — from JavaScript string to hex dump to permission bitmask.

Parity and error detection context
Serial protocols sometimes include parity bits outside the 7/8 data bits this tool displays. When documentation shows 9-bit frames, extract data bits manually before translation — the parity bit is not part of the character encoding.
Morse code distinction
Binary translation maps fixed-width bit patterns to characters. Morse code uses variable-length dot-dash sequences — a different encoding entirely. Do not feed Morse into this decoder expecting ASCII output.
Teaching binary without calculators
Instructor workflow: encode student name, swap laptops, decode neighbor's output. Mismatches reveal whether error is encoding direction, bit width selection, or separator handling — three distinct bugs beginners conflate into "binary doesn't work."

Frequently Asked Questions
- What is 8-bit vs 7-bit mode?
- 7-bit ASCII covers English characters 0-127. 8-bit mode uses full bytes (0-255), required for extended ASCII and UTF-8 multibyte sequences when encoding character by character.
- Why does binary to text fail?
- The bit stream length must be an exact multiple of the selected bit width. Stray spaces or incomplete final bytes cause decode errors.
- Is this the same as Base64?
- No. Binary translation shows raw bit patterns per character. Base64 encodes arbitrary byte streams into a compact ASCII-safe alphabet for transport.
- Can I decode UTF-8 emoji in binary mode?
- Emoji require multiple 8-bit bytes per character. Encode the full UTF-8 string in text-to-binary mode rather than decoding arbitrary bit patterns as emoji.
- Who uses binary text encoding?
- Computer science courses, CTF puzzles, RFID bit layouts, and legacy teletype systems all reference character-to-bit mappings this tool visualizes.
